CEO Forum

Thursday, June 25, 2009

"The G'dayUK CEO Forum will bring business leaders together from ‘down under’ and ‘up here' to share ideas and current trends in business, finance and climate change in the most challenging economic environment for a century” Phil Aiken, Chairman, G'dayUK & Australian Business

Sponsored by CPA Australia and managed on behalf of G'dayUK by Australian Business, this CEO Forum promises to be one of the most significant events in the 2009 business calendar.

At a central and iconic venue within London, In the presence of John Dauth LVO, Australian High Commissioner, speakers are:
- The Hon Stephen Smith MP, Australian Minister for Foreign Affairs
- The Hon Chris Bowen MP, Australian Assistant Treasurer and Minister for Competition Policy and Consumer Affairs
- Rt Hon Lord Mandelson, UK Secretary of State for Business Enterprise and Regulatory Reform
- Heather Ridout, CEO of the Australian Industry Group

The CEO Forum aims to help to develop closer trade and investment links with the UK (currently the second largest source of investment into Australia). It will provide a platform for knowledge exchange in the face of the worst financial crisis in decades. Delegates will be able to share ideas and update each other on advances in policies and business expertise in each of the four forum areas:
